After “wasting time” go-karting and playing mini-golf, we finally got to check into the house! It is big and beautiful and a two minute walk from the beach. If you are planning a vacation, especially one with children, I would look into the prices of renting a house. It was cheaper for us, rather than renting two hotel rooms and it is so much easier. There is a washer and dryer, lots of room and a full kitchen. I wish I would have taken picture before we threw all of our stuff around!
